Plant body is unicellular, pear-shaped and biflagellate.Each cell has generally cup-shaped chloroplast, one eye-spot and two contractile vacuoles.Presence of palmella-stage.Asexual reproduction takes place through biflagellate zoospore formation.

Is Chlamydomonas an algae or Protista?Classification. Actually, Chlamydomonas is currently considered to be a protist. The division to which it belongs, the Chlorophyta, has been reclassified under the kingdom Protista following recent biochemical studies.

Morphology: Chlamydomonas is single celled, and has an almost spherical cell wall around the cytoplasm and centralized nucleus. They have two flagella extending out of one side that propel them about.

Chlamydomonas, genus of biflagellated single-celled green algae (family Chlamydomonadaceae) found in soil, ponds, and ditches. Chlamydomonas species can become so abundant as to colour fresh water green, and one species, C. … Red snow caused by Chlamydomonas nivalis.

Chlamydomonas reinhardtii is a unicellular eukaryotic alga possessing a single chloroplast that is widely used as a model system for the study of photosynthetic processes.

Chlamydomonas has been an important organism for establishing the role of carbonic anhydrase (CA) in eukaryotic CCMs. CA catalyzes the interconversion of CO2 and HCO3−, and plants use it to facilitate the transport and accumulation of carbonate species within particular organelles.

The key difference between Chlamydomonas and spirogyra is that Chlamydomonas is a single-celled spherical-shaped green alga which is highly motile while spirogyra is a multicellular filamentous green alga which has spirally arranged chloroplasts.

Diatoms have two distinct shapes: a few (centric diatoms) are radially symmetric, while most (pennate diatoms) are broadly bilaterally symmetric. A unique feature of diatom anatomy is that they are surrounded by a cell wall made of silica (hydrated silicon dioxide), called a frustule.

Chlamydomonas sexually reproduces through the involvement of two gametes: Isogamy: Both of the gametes that are produced are similar in shape, size and structure. These are morphologically similar but physiologically different. Also, Isogamy is most common in sexually reproducing Chlamydomonas.
